A shocking report has revealed that Pakistan yearly wastes food worth $4 billion. According to a report by the Ministry of National Food Security & Research, Pakistan yearly wastes 26% of its food production yearly. The yearly food waste in Pakistan is 19.6 million tonnes, the report revealed. The report further revealed that most food items are wasted for not meeting the criteria of appearance, size and color despite the steps to ensure food security.
